Plan and conduct engaging dance classes for students from different age groups and skill levels.
Teach basic and advanced dance techniques, movements, rhythm, coordination, and expressions.
Prepare students for school events, annual day celebrations, cultural programs, competitions, and special occasions.
Create age-appropriate dance routines and choreography suitable for school performances.
Encourage students to participate actively and build confidence through dance.
Maintain discipline, safety, and a positive learning environment during dance sessions.
Identify students’ strengths and provide appropriate guidance to improve their skills.
Organize regular practice sessions and ensure students are well-prepared for performances.
Introduce students to different dance forms and cultural styles as appropriate.
Coordinate with class teachers and school management regarding performances and events.
Maintain proper attendance and provide feedback on students’ participation and progress.
Ensure appropriate use and care of dance equipment, costumes, props, and activity spaces.
Stay updated with new dance trends, techniques, and creative choreography methods.
Contribute to the overall development of students through creativity, teamwork, discipline, and self-expression.
